About This Scholarship

The purpose of the North Carolina Education Lottery Scholarship is to provide financial assistance to North Carolina residents with financial need who are attending North Carolina colleges and universities. Applicants must be enrolled for at least six credit hours per semester in an undergraduate degree-seeking program at an eligible North Carolina institution and meet satisfactory academic progress requirements. Students who meet the same criteria as the Federal Pell Grant and those with an Estimated Family Contribution of $5,000 or less are eligible for the scholarship.

When applying for scholarships, you should NEVER have to pay to apply. You should also NEVER have to provide sensitive personal information like your Social Security Number (SSN). If membership is required to apply, the membership should ALWAYS BE FREE. Basically, NEVER PAY FOR ANYTHING. Those are scams! Some scholarships may ask for your address or proof of enrollment. That's fine, but always verify you're actually talking to the scholarship provider and not an imposter. Scams in scholarships are rampant, be careful!
